Penoche Recipe

Ingredients:

1 cup brown sugar
2 cups white sugar
1 1/2 cup Sego milk
2 Tbsp. butter
1 tsp. vanilla
1 cup walnuts

Directions:

Mix sugar and milk well. Bring to the boiling point, stirring until sugar is dissolved. Cook to 236º or until a small amount when dropped into cooled water will form a soft ball. Add butter and cool until lukewarm, then beat until creamy. Add vanilla and nuts. Pour into greased pan. when cold, cut into squares.

If mixture should curdle, it will be smooth after beating.
